Output ecde018bdbe34d1a8a39d6fc892b99c4d34d2d905d70bc3f4a70f2c54998aa73:20

value
5344546048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c2d983470d357d4b5f27098e12e3c0fa54b6413 OP_EQUALVERIFY OP_CHECKSIG
address
1FEo2teQdV7Dkbg87MYQ8asCRkPnhc427t
transaction
ecde018bdbe34d1a8a39d6fc892b99c4d34d2d905d70bc3f4a70f2c54998aa73
spent
true